2006 Jesuit Jubilee Year Celebration

Background:

Celebrating the Spirit of the following Founders of the Society of Jesus: Saint Ignatius Loyola, Saint Francisco de Jassu y Javier and Blessed Pierre Favre. (more info here).

Celebration at Blessed Sacrament Parish:

December 3 & 4, 2005. Blessed Sacrament Church, Hollywood: The parish celebrated the beginning of the 2006 Jubilee Year at all the Masses on December 3 and 4. Picture below shows the shrine set up for St. Ignatius Loyola, St. Francis Xavier and Bl. Peter Favre.
